I think that the African-American families across this country will not have the full impact they deserve until they are involved in both parties in big numbers. You should encourage those in your community who are more inclined to be of a conservative bend in life to become Republicans. Of the 39 African-Americans in this Congress, I wish we had not just one on my side of the aisle, but instead 38 or 40 or 50, to match the same number on your side of the aisle.
